Technical report on the technical analysis of the technical annex to the third biennial update report of Brazil submitted in accordance with decision 14/CP.19, paragraph 7, on 2 March 2019

Abstract

This technical report covers the technical analysis of the technical annex submitted on a voluntary basis, in the context of results-based payments, by Brazil on 2 March 2019 through its third biennial update report in accordance with decision 14/CP.19. The technical annex provides data and information on the activity reducing emissions from deforestation, which is an activity included in decision 1/CP.16, paragraph 70, and covers the same subnational territorial forest area as the assessed forest reference emission level (FREL) for the Amazon biome proposed by Brazil in its FREL C submission of 15 January 2018.

Brazil reported the results of the implementation of this activity for 2016–2017, which amount to 769,000,872.94 tonnes of carbon dioxide and were measured against the assessed FREL of 751,780,503.37 tonnes of carbon dioxide per year for 1996–2015.

The data and information provided in the technical annex are in overall accordance with the guidelines contained in the annex to decision 14/CP.19. The technical analysis concluded that the data and information provided by Brazil in the technical annex are transparent and consistent with the assessed FREL established in accordance with decision 1/CP.16, paragraph 71(b), and decision 12/CP.17, section II. This report contains the findings from the technical analysis and a few areas identified for capacity-building and future technical improvement in accordance with decision 14/CP.19, paragraph 14.
